Why do barbers quit? ›

It Can Be Draining

You are not just standing, you are rotating, angling, stooping, craning, and requiring all-out physical exertion to do your job right. Sometimes, barbers simply can't hack it because their bodies can't handle the extended periods of physical exertion.

What not to do before a haircut? ›

It's generally not ideal to arrive with heavy product build-up from styling your hair the day of your appointment, especially if you're getting a dry cut or highlights before washing. It can cause hair color to go on unevenly and affect how your hair stylist evaluates your pre-cut hair type and texture.

What does a number 3 haircut look like? ›

Number 3. This clipper size cuts to a length of ⅜ inches to about 7/16 inches if it's open. If you're opting for a fade, it might be best to ask your barber to start with a 3 so then they can move down to a 2 and lower as they fade it out. It also helps you keep more of your length.

What is the number 2 haircut? ›

Although still very short, the popular number two clipper guard is also used for buzz cuts and fades. However, because the hair is a quarter of an inch long the scalp is not exposed in the way that it is with a zero or one cut. This makes it a good cut for guys who have thin hair or who are balding.
